Philmont stays with you long after you leave. Whether you’ve stood on the Tooth of Time, sent a crew, served on staff, attended a conference, or believe in what this place represents, you are part of the Philmont story. 

 

Friends of Philmont is a community of supporters who help care for the Ranch, strengthen programs, and ensure that future generations experience the adventure, leadership, and connection to the outdoors that define Philmont.

Friends of Philmont Experiences

All Friends have the opportunity to participate in a rotating calendar of unique Philmont experiences throughout the year, which may include: 

Behind-The-Scenes &

Immersive Access:

See Behind-the-scenes of  Ranch operations, including facilities, food logistics, conservation work, livestock, and museum programs, paired with exclusive virtual and in-person experiences.

Service and conservation engagement:

Hands-on service and conservation opportunities that directly support the Ranch while allowing participants to contribute to the land and its long-term sustainability actively.

Creative, educational, and skill-based experiences:

Creative and learning retreats, including photography, writing, music, painting, and outdoor skills, offering opportunities for both personal development and skill-building in a Philmont setting.

Flexible and varied adventure options:

Flexible adventure experiences such as day hikes, short backcountry overnights, and seasonal themed weekends, along with unique program formats like hut-to-hut style treks and pilot programs that expand beyond traditional trek structures.

Connection and continued engagement:

Opportunities to reconnect through reunion crews or shared experiences with family and friends, supported by seasonal and rotating offerings that provide new ways to experience Philmont throughout the year
